How to Determine Your Class
To find the correct freight class for your shipment:
- Confirm the exact aluminum form (sheet, extrusion, casting, scrap) and match it to the correct item-specific NMFC rather than relying on this group header.
- Package by geometry: band extrusions in tight bundles on wood pallets; crate thin sheets with edge protection and interleaving to prevent scuffing.
- Stabilize loads with stretch-wrap and blocking; avoid metal-on-metal rub that causes finish damage or freight claims during LTL cross-dock moves.
- Mark paperwork with alloy description and packaging method (e.g., “palletized bundles”) to help carriers price correctly when class is not defined.
Note: All classifications are subject to Item 170. Verify with official NMFC publications for the most current requirements.
